Why this role

As the Director of Site Reliability Engineering, reporting to our VP of Platform Engineering, you will own the core infrastructure layers that everything at Doctolib runs on: cloud infrastructure, database operations, network infrastructure, and observability. You will also lead the Doctolib Operations Center (DOC) and drive a decisive shift from reactive operations to a proactive, world‑class reliability culture.

This is a rare opportunity to shape the infrastructure backbone of Europe’s leading healthtech company at a moment when Doctolib is actively expanding multi‑cloud capabilities, scaling to new countries, and building the reliability culture that will define the next decade of healthcare innovation.

What you’ll do

  • Build and run a world‑class SRE org of 25+ engineers across Cloud Infrastructure, Database Storage, Network Infrastructure, Observability Tooling, and the Doctolib Operations Center.
  • Own the infrastructure strategy and roadmap—cloud, database, network, observability—and deliver against company OKRs.
  • Lead the Doctolib Operations Center: set incident response standards, drive MTTR reduction, embed blameless post‑mortem culture across engineering.
  • Architect and execute our multi‑cloud strategy—reducing vendor lock‑in, cutting migration costs, and enabling international expansion.
  • Own network infrastructure at scale: load balancing, CDN/WAF, VPCs, peering, zero‑trust networking across a high‑traffic, multi‑country platform.
  • Drive observability as a product—give 700+ engineers true visibility into system health and turn observability maturity into an operational excellence lever.
  • Lead from the front as a senior technical voice in the Platform org and broader Tech leadership team.

Who you are

  • 12+ years in software engineering, including 5+ years leading managers and running infrastructure or SRE organizations at scale.
  • Track record of taking SRE practices from reactive to proactive—measurable reductions in incidents and MTTR.
  • Strong multi‑cloud and network infrastructure experience: load balancing, CDN/WAF, VPCs, peering at high‑traffic scale.
  • Deep database operations background: large‑scale transactional systems (PostgreSQL, Aurora), streaming/CDC (Kafka), data layer FinOps.
  • Experience building observability platforms that give teams genuine visibility—metrics, logs, traces, alerting.
  • Sharp process thinking: SLOs, error budgets, incident management, blameless post‑mortems.
  • Outcome‑driven: track reliability, cost efficiency, and engineering velocity as business metrics, not just technical ones.
  • Strong communicator and influencer at executive level—credible with senior engineers and business stakeholders.
  • Builder of high‑performing, people‑first engineering cultures.
  • Fluent in English; comfortable in fast‑paced, international environments.
